VETT: An innovation in remote transaction security
One small company has already benefited from directional assistance from UK Innovation Initiative It is VETT, a Nottinghamshire based innovative small company which provides remote transaction security for financial institutions that does not require the exchange or use of personal data by individuals making transactions between each other.

VETT technology creates a secure environment for e-commerce enabling people and business to conduct commercial transactions without the necessity to exchange private account data. VETT can be used for retail and B2B payments, for procurement and identity verification. After listening to our pitch Martin said tell me: why I should buy a license for your technology when I could just build my own system?
Good question, most Inventors and Designers would answer: “because it’s protected by patent”. Well the sad truth is if you don’t have at least £1 million to burn in court costs that’s not a very convincing answer. Further conversation helped to reveal not our USP, but our unique commercial advantage. The ‘thing’ which gives us a real edge over the competition.
